Transaction 581a7f6a17e9427a38f03ad4f21d3478006605ffd0618b94a163512d6e5533bf
2 Input
2 Outputs
- 581a7f6a17e9427a38f03ad4f21d3478006605ffd0618b94a163512d6e5533bf:0
- 581a7f6a17e9427a38f03ad4f21d3478006605ffd0618b94a163512d6e5533bf:1
value 739143
address 1G6asw4udRtuvbAvVYvdf53FqMCwp3es7D
value 12183928
address 1HGhJptTCcipCGiqQCNt1xv1GrRUqmVdhe